Differences between an Interior Designer and an Interior Decorator

A majority of interior design professionals are employed by architectural or construction firms and work along with architects and builders to design spaces that are usable for a range of human activities. Interior designers are also used for creating a beautiful and functional set of interior spaces for a home. Usually, though, interior design experts work for contractors and builders rather than working directly for private individuals.


Interior decorators are generally hired by homeowners to boost the aesthetic appeal of current space. These interior decorators generally specialize in residential or commercial spaces and may use wall treatments, lighting, furnishings, accessories or flooring to design a look that is pleasing to the manager or owner of the space.



Why do you need to hire a designer or decorator?


Qualified interior designers help create functional spaces for living and working. Builders and contractors depend on these professionals to offer advice on a range of ergonomic issues.
